Output 25050fa775977def7c4750f99222dc03e789d81a6d7e2b789d3af8761113a88f:1

value
1589881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15b41cd63cd23ceadcdbe6bedc01c2f99149ce3b OP_EQUAL
address
33fmt217TPnmPQnqZFL3FKTwxMxbWGVs33
transaction
25050fa775977def7c4750f99222dc03e789d81a6d7e2b789d3af8761113a88f
spent
true